Optical-Fiber Cable
If you need a very high degree of noise immunity or information security, consider the use of
optical fiber instead of UTP. Optical fiber is a medium that uses changes in light intensity to
carry information from one point to another. An optical-fiber system consists of a light source,
optical fiber, and a light detector. A light source changes digital electrical signals into light
(that is, on for a logic 1 and off for a logic 0), the optical fiber transports the light to the destination,
and a light detector transforms the light into an electrical signal.
The main advantages of optical fiber are very high bandwidth (megabits per second and gigabits
per second), information security, immunity to electromagnetic interference, lightweight
construction, and long-distance operation without signal regeneration. As a result, optical fiber
is superior for bandwidth-demanding applications and protocols, operation in classified areas
and between buildings, and installation in airplanes and ships. IEEE 802.3’s 10Base-F and
100Base-F specifications identify the use of optical fiber as the physical medium. Of course,
FDDI identifies the use of optical fiber as well.
